func (r *ReplicationReconciler) Reconcile(ctx context.Context, mdb *mariadbv1alpha1.MariaDB) (ctrl.Result, error) {
if !mdb.IsReplicationEnabled() {
return ctrl.Result{}, nil
}
logger := log.FromContext(ctx).WithName("replication")
switchoverLogger := log.FromContext(ctx).WithName("switchover")
req, err := r.NewReconcileRequest(ctx, mdb)
if err != nil {
return ctrl.Result{}, fmt.Errorf("error creating reconcile request: %v", err)
}
defer req.Close()
if mdb.IsSwitchoverRequired() {
return ctrl.Result{}, r.reconcileSwitchover(ctx, req, switchoverLogger)
}
if result, err := r.reconcileReplication(ctx, req, logger); !result.IsZero() || err != nil {
return result, err
}
return ctrl.Result{}, r.reconcileSwitchover(ctx, req, switchoverLogger)
}
func (r *ReplicationReconciler) reconcileReplication(ctx context.Context, req *ReconcileRequest, logger logr.Logger) (ctrl.Result, error) {
if result, err := r.shouldReconcileReplication(ctx, req, logger); !result.IsZero() || err != nil {
return result, err
}
for _, i := range r.replicationPodIndexes(ctx, req) {
if result, err := r.ReconcileReplicationInPod(ctx, req, i, logger); !result.IsZero() || err != nil {
return result, err
}
}
if !req.mariadb.HasConfiguredReplication() {
if err := r.patchStatus(ctx, req.mariadb, func(status *mariadbv1alpha1.MariaDBStatus) {
conditions.SetReplicationConfigured(status)
}); err != nil {
return ctrl.Result{}, err
}
}
return ctrl.Result{}, nil
}
func (r *ReplicationReconciler) shouldReconcileReplication(ctx context.Context, req *ReconcileRequest,
logger logr.Logger) (ctrl.Result, error) {
if req.mariadb.Status.CurrentPrimaryPodIndex == nil {
return ctrl.Result{RequeueAfter: 1 * time.Second}, nil
}
if req.mariadb.IsSwitchingPrimary() {
return ctrl.Result{}, nil
}
if req.mariadb.IsMaxScaleEnabled() {
mxs, err := r.refResolver.MaxScale(ctx, req.mariadb.Spec.MaxScaleRef, req.mariadb.Namespace)
if err != nil {
// MaxScale is not present, so no conflict can occur. Safe to proceed with replication reconciliation.
if apierrors.IsNotFound(err) {
return ctrl.Result{}, nil
}
return ctrl.Result{}, fmt.Errorf("error getting MaxScale: %v", err)
}
if mxs.IsSwitchingPrimary() {
logger.Info("MaxScale is switching primary. Requeuing..")
return ctrl.Result{RequeueAfter: 5 * time.Second}, nil
}
}
return ctrl.Result{}, nil
}
func (r *ReplicationReconciler) replicationPodIndexes(ctx context.Context, req *ReconcileRequest) []int {
podIndexes := []int{
*req.mariadb.Status.CurrentPrimaryPodIndex,
}
for i := 0; i < int(req.mariadb.Spec.Replicas); i++ {
if i != *req.mariadb.Status.CurrentPrimaryPodIndex {
podIndexes = append(podIndexes, i)
}
}
return podIndexes
}

func (r *ReplicationReconciler) ReconcileReplicationInPod(ctx context.Context, req *ReconcileRequest, podIndex int,
logger logr.Logger, reconcilePodOpts ...ReconcilePodOpt) (ctrl.Result, error) {
opts := ReconcilePodOpts{}
for _, setOpt := range reconcilePodOpts {
setOpt(&opts)
}
primaryPodIndex := *req.mariadb.Status.CurrentPrimaryPodIndex
replStatus := ptr.Deref(req.mariadb.Status.Replication, mariadbv1alpha1.ReplicationStatus{})
replRoles := replStatus.Roles
pod := statefulset.PodName(req.mariadb.ObjectMeta, podIndex)
if primaryPodIndex == podIndex {
if role, ok := replRoles[pod]; ok && role == mariadbv1alpha1.ReplicationRolePrimary {
return ctrl.Result{}, nil
}
client, err := req.replClientSet.currentPrimaryClient(ctx)
if err != nil {
logger.V(1).Info("error getting current primary client", "err", err, "pod", pod)
return ctrl.Result{RequeueAfter: 5 * time.Second}, nil
}
logger.Info("Configuring primary", "pod", pod)
if err := r.replConfigClient.ConfigurePrimary(ctx, req.mariadb, client); err != nil {
return ctrl.Result{}, fmt.Errorf("error configuring replica: %v", err)
}
return ctrl.Result{}, nil
}
if !opts.forceReplicaConfiguration {
role, ok := replRoles[pod]
if ok && role == mariadbv1alpha1.ReplicationRoleReplica {
return ctrl.Result{}, nil
}
}
client, err := req.replClientSet.clientForIndex(ctx, podIndex)
if err != nil {
logger.V(1).Info("error getting replica client", "err", err, "pod", pod)
return ctrl.Result{RequeueAfter: 5 * time.Second}, nil
}
logger.Info("Configuring replica", "pod", pod)
replicaOpts, err := r.getReplicaOpts(ctx, req, pod, podIndex, logger, reconcilePodOpts...)
if err != nil {
return ctrl.Result{}, fmt.Errorf("error getting replica opts: %v", err)
}
if err := r.replConfigClient.ConfigureReplica(ctx, req.mariadb, client, primaryPodIndex, replicaOpts...); err != nil {
return ctrl.Result{}, fmt.Errorf("error configuring replica: %v", err)
}
return ctrl.Result{}, nil
}
func (r *ReplicationReconciler) getReplicaOpts(ctx context.Context, req *ReconcileRequest, pod string, index int,
logger logr.Logger, reconcilePodOpts ...ReconcilePodOpt) ([]ConfigureReplicaOpt, error) {
opts := ReconcilePodOpts{}
for _, setOpt := range reconcilePodOpts {
setOpt(&opts)
}
if !opts.forceReplicaConfiguration {
return nil, nil
}
var gtid string
if opts.volumeSnapshotKey != nil {
var snapshot volumesnapshotv1.VolumeSnapshot
if err := r.Get(ctx, *opts.volumeSnapshotKey, &snapshot); err != nil {
return nil, fmt.Errorf("error getting %s VolumeSnapshot: %v", (*opts.volumeSnapshotKey).Name, err)
}
snapshotGtid, ok := snapshot.Annotations[metadata.GtidAnnotation]
if !ok {
return nil, fmt.Errorf("could not find GTID annotation %s in VolumeSnapshot", metadata.GtidAnnotation)
}
gtid = snapshotGtid
logger.Info("Got replica GTID from VolumeSnapshot", "pod", pod, "gtid", gtid, "snapshot", snapshot.Name)
} else {
agentClient, err := req.agentClientSet.ClientForIndex(index)
if err != nil {
return nil, fmt.Errorf("error getting agent client: %v", err)
}
agentGtid, err := agentClient.Replication.GetGtid(ctx)
if err != nil {
return nil, fmt.Errorf("error requesting GTID to agent: %v", err)
}
gtid = agentGtid
logger.Info("Got replica GTID from agent", "pod", pod, "gtid", gtid)
}
changeMasterGtid, err := mariadbv1alpha1.GtidSlavePos.MariaDBFormat()
if err != nil {
return nil, fmt.Errorf("error getting change master GTID: %v", err)
}
return []ConfigureReplicaOpt{
WithGtidSlavePos(gtid),
WithChangeMasterOpts(
sql.WithChangeMasterGtid(changeMasterGtid),
),
}, nil
}
